Shedeur Sanders makes unexpected gesture for Glenville after 11 players face charges in $4,500 sports store theft

Shedeur Sanders has donated about 50 pairs of Nike cleats to Glenville High School after 11 football players faced theft charges in Ohio. The players were accused of taking more than $4,500 in merchandise from Dick’s Sporting Goods. While the school has suspended them and removed them from two games, Sanders continues to support his Cleveland football community.
